As a family we have been staying here every Easter for over 10 years now and have never had a complaint towards this accommodation. We have stayed on many different floors and changed up to the three bedroom apartments over the years due to a growing family. The apartments main living area's are very roomy and the views from either side of the building are always exceptional towards Surfers or south towards Coolangatta. The units are self contained and only once (the first ever visit) did we have to buy containers to store items in the fridge. All other visits we have never had to supplement anything from the kitchen. The building is getting old, but we have been there when outside maintenance and painting has been done to keep it updated and fresh. Like any normal accommodation, inside the apartments can show some wear and tear. The heated pool is a convenience for days when the weather is foul. The games room is minimal if you had older children, but in this day and age many would take their own systems to connect in their room. Road access throughout the Coast is easy from here. Up or down the GC highway or up Christine Ave (at nearest intersection) to gain access to Robina for shopping or new NRL footy stadium. The beach opposite the apartments has the North Burleigh Life Savers club and the beach is always manned for safe swimming. A short 5 minute stroll will bring you to the GC highway and the usual little shopping village. Recently a Coles has been built, along with a common coffee outlet, bottlo's, bakery, chemist, etc. The only two downers I can put on this place is when the weather turns cold and the wind is blowing - bring your winter woollies - it gets extremely cold out on the balcony. The second is if youre going to have any Pay TV - make it more worthwhile instead of sports.
